Quote:
I hope Ram and Yori are in Series 2... no idea who the 3rd person would be though... the guard with the pole I guess. That probably means no Series 3... not enough main characters.
I hope so too, but the fact they shot their wadd with wave 1 means they almost certainly aren't going to do a second wave. They should have done Tron, Sark and Guard wave 1, then Flynn, Ram and Yori wave 2. Ram could easily reuse the same buck as Tron / Flynn.

Quote:
Online preorders for this wave may have been less than ideal, which could be why the Recognizer got cancelled from the set and the price per figure lowered. Maybe they shouldn't have already offered the same Tron and Sark figures (with less accessories) for sale at Walgreens stores last year. I suspect many people just settled for getting those rather than ordering the higher priced online versions that were taking forever to get released. If this is the negative result of all that, then the blue Flynn variant should have been the only figure offered exclusively at Walgreens so that it wouldn't harm the sales of the other figures in the wave.
Lots of people wait to see reviews before they order figures, so I can't see why companies lean so hard on preorders - especially when in this case they chose to release the same figures at a lower cost at retail months before! Crazy!

Quote:
On the flipside, I wonder how well those "discount" versions of the figures sold at Walgreens and if Walgreens might support DST in doing a 2nd wave exclusive to the store. I'd gladly get a 2nd wave with less accessories at Walgreens if it means we can get Yori, Ram, and a Sentry Guard.
Truth is - we don't need effects pieces for Ram, Yori or the Guard - just their 'weapons'. I really do hope wave 1 sold well enough for a wave 2...
